Преглед изворни кода

msm:ADSPRPC: adding spin_unlock when bailing.

spin_lock should be released before bailing.

Change-Id: I3ac6043221272fa1dda2f36f4add810df41a17f3
Acked-by: ANANDU E <[email protected]>
Signed-off-by: Vamsi Krishna Gattupalli <[email protected]>
Vamsi Krishna Gattupalli пре 2 година
родитељ
комит
0821b24a81
1 измењених фајлова са 1 додато и 0 уклоњено
  1. 1 0
      dsp/adsprpc.c

+ 1 - 0
dsp/adsprpc.c

@@ -3661,6 +3661,7 @@ static int fastrpc_init_create_dynamic_process(struct fastrpc_file *fl,
 			    "init memory for process %d should be between %d and %d\n",
 			     init->memlen, INIT_MEMLEN_MIN_DYNAMIC, INIT_MEMLEN_MAX_DYNAMIC);
 		    err = -EINVAL;
+		    spin_unlock(&fl->hlock);
 		    goto bail;
 		}
 		dsp_userpd_memlen = init->memlen;